What Are the Key Benefits of Barrier Fencing?
Feb. 04, 2026
Barrier fencing is an essential safety measure used in various environments, including construction sites, events, and public spaces. Understanding the key benefits of this type of fencing can help stakeholders make informed decisions to enhance safety and efficiency.

One of the primary advantages of barrier fencing is its role in construction worksite protection. According to the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A), over 20% of construction site injuries are caused by falls, which could be significantly minimized with effective barriers. Barrier fencing acts as a physical boundary that prevents unauthorized access and keeps pedestrians away from potentially hazardous areas. This is particularly crucial in busy urban environments where the risk of injury must be actively managed.
In addition to enhancing safety, barrier fencing is also beneficial for maintaining site security. A report by the National Association of Home Builders (NAHB) stated that theft and vandalism are significant concerns on construction sites, costing the industry an estimated $1 billion annually. Installing strong barrier fencing can deter intruders, safeguarding valuable equipment and materials. In locations with high crime rates, investing in robust barrier fencing for construction worksite protection can save costs in the long run by reducing theft.
Moreover, barrier fencing serves to improve organization on a construction site. According to a study by the Construction Industry Institute, sites that utilize proper barriers report a 27% increase in productivity. By clearly outlining designated work areas, public zones, and storage spaces, workers can navigate the site more efficiently, leading to streamlined workflows.
Another compelling benefit is the promotion of compliance with local regulations. Many municipalities require construction sites to have safety measures in place, including barrier fencing. Failure to comply can result in fines and project delays. A report from the American Society of Civil Engineers (ASCE) indicates that compliance issues account for approximately 30% of project setbacks. Therefore, installing barrier fencing can help ensure adherence to legal standards, avoiding potential legal hassles.
Barrier fencing also enhances the visibility of the construction site. When properly marked, these fences can alert passersby to the presence of hazards, as emphasized in a report by the Federal Highway Administration. Visibility is crucial, especially in urban settings where construction activities can be intrusive to daily life. Clear signage paired with barrier fencing not only guarantees safety but also improves the public’s perception of the construction project.
Durability is another key factor to consider. Barrier fencing is often designed to withstand various environmental conditions. According to The National Association of Professional Women, quality fencing can last for years with minimal maintenance. Choosing durable materials for barrier fencing can save costs associated with replacements and repairs over time, making it a smart investment for construction companies.
From a financial perspective, barrier fencing can be a cost-effective solution. A comprehensive analysis published by the Construction Research Institute found that investing in effective site safety measures, including barrier fencing, can yield a return of up to $3 for every $1 spent. This ROI reinforces the notion that prioritizing safety through barrier fencing for construction worksite protection can lead to significant financial benefits.
In summary, the key benefits of barrier fencing include enhanced safety, improved security, increased site organization, compliance with regulations, better site visibility, durability, and financial advantages. By investing in barrier fencing, construction companies can protect their workers, comply with laws, save money, and ultimately ensure a more productive and efficient work environment.
